Add support for LLVM ShadowCallStack. LLVMs ShadowCallStack provides backward edge control flow integrity protection by using a separate shadow stack to store and retrieve a function's return address. LLVM currently only supports this for AArch64 targets. The x18 register is used to hold the pointer to the shadow stack, and therefore this only works on ABIs which reserve x18. Further details are available in the [LLVM ShadowCallStack](https://clang.llvm.org/docs/ShadowCallStack.html) docs. # Usage `-Zsanitizer=shadow-call-stack` # Comments/Caveats * Currently only enabled for the aarch64-linux-android target * Requires the platform to define a runtime to initialize the shadow stack, see the [LLVM docs](https://clang.llvm.org/docs/ShadowCallStack.html) for more detail.

Allow to disable thinLTO buffer to support lto-embed-bitcode lld feature Hello This change is to fix issue (https://github.com/rust-lang/rust/issues/84395) in which passing "-lto-embed-bitcode=optimized" to lld when linking rust code via linker-plugin-lto doesn't produce the expected result. Instead of emitting a single unified module into a llvmbc section of the linked elf, it emits multiple submodules. This is caused because rustc emits the BC modules after running llvm `createWriteThinLTOBitcodePass` pass. Which in turn triggers a thinLTO linkage and causes the said issue. This patch allows via compiler flag (-Cemit-thin-lto=<bool>) to select between running `createWriteThinLTOBitcodePass` and `createBitcodeWriterPass`. Note this pattern of selecting between those 2 passes is common inside of LLVM code. The default is to match the old behavior.

2022-07-08Implement support for DWARF version 5.Patrick Walton-0/+2
DWARF version 5 brings a number of improvements over version 4. Quoting from the announcement [1]: > Version 5 incorporates improvements in many areas: better data compression, > separation of debugging data from executable files, improved description of > macros and source files, faster searching for symbols, improved debugging > optimized code, as well as numerous improvements in functionality and > performance. On platforms where DWARF version 5 is supported (Linux, primarily), this commit adds support for it behind a new `-Z dwarf-version=5` flag. [1]: https://dwarfstd.org/Public_Review.php

Introduce `-Zvirtual-function-elimination` codegen flag Fixes #68262 This PR adds a codegen flag `-Zvirtual-function-elimination` to enable the VFE optimization in LLVM. To make this work, additonal information has to be added to vtables ([`!vcall_visibility` metadata](https://llvm.org/docs/TypeMetadata.html#vcall-visibility-metadata) and a `typeid` of the trait). Furthermore, instead of just `load`ing functions, the [`llvm.type.checked.load` intrinsic](https://llvm.org/docs/LangRef.html#llvm-type-checked-load-intrinsic) has to be used to map functions to vtables. For technical details of the changes, see the commit messages. I also tested this flag on https://github.com/tock/tock on different boards to verify that this fixes the issue https://github.com/tock/tock/issues/2594. This flag is able to improve the size of the resulting binary by about 8k-9k bytes by removing the unused debug print functions. Implement -Z oom=panic This PR removes the `#[rustc_allocator_nounwind]` attribute on `alloc_error_handler` which allows it to unwind with a panic instead of always aborting. This is then used to implement `-Z oom=panic` as per RFC 2116 (tracking issue #43596). Perf and binary size tests show negligible impact.

No branch protection metadata unless enabled Even if we emit metadata disabling branch protection, this metadata may conflict with other modules (e.g. during LTO) that have different branch protection metadata set. This is an unstable flag and feature, so ideally the flag not being specified should act as if the feature wasn't implemented in the first place. Additionally this PR also ensures we emit an error if `-Zbranch-protection` is set on targets other than the supported aarch64. For now the error is being output from codegen, but ideally it should be moved to earlier in the pipeline before stabilization.

Add MemTagSanitizer Support Add support for the LLVM [MemTagSanitizer](https://llvm.org/docs/MemTagSanitizer.html). On hardware which supports it (see caveats below), the MemTagSanitizer can catch bugs similar to AddressSanitizer and HardwareAddressSanitizer, but with lower overhead. On a tag mismatch, a SIGSEGV is signaled with code SEGV_MTESERR / SEGV_MTEAERR. # Usage `-Zsanitizer=memtag -C target-feature="+mte"` # Comments/Caveats * MemTagSanitizer is only supported on AArch64 targets with hardware support * Requires `-C target-feature="+mte"` * LLVM MemTagSanitizer currently only performs stack tagging. # TODO * Tests * Example
